Narinder Singh’s BrokerCheck report, a public record maintained by FINRA, states that Singh has been the subject of five customer complaints. The recent complaints allege that Singh made unsuitable recommendations to invest in Express Asset and Wealth Management, a company owned by Singh.
Narinder Singh was a registered representative of ProEquities from July 2016 to December 2017. He was also with Transamerica Financial Advisors from November 2014 to July 2016 and Farmers Financial Solutions from January 2018 to November 2019. Singh has worked in offices in Elk Grove and Sacramento, California. It is believed that Express Asset and Wealth Management was owned and operated by Singh.
Brokerage firms like ProEquities, Transamerica Financial Advisors, and Farmers Financial Solutions have a responsibility to adequately supervise all representatives who are registered through their firm. Brokerage firms also must take steps to ensure that their financial advisors follow all securities rules and regulations, as well as internal firm policies. When brokerage firms fail to adequately supervise their registered representatives, they may be liable for investment losses sustained by customers.
